An original painting by an artist from Beer, worth up to £1,400, is up for grabs in a sealed bid charity auction.
Andrew Coates has donated an original abstract oil painting, called Light Works China Trip 2015, to the Seaton and District Branch of the RNLI.
Wendy Cummins, secretary of the branch, thanked Andrew for his support and said the group was inviting bids starting from £400.
The painting can be viewed at Marine House Gallery.
Sealed envelopes should be dropped into the Marine House Gallery in Beer, or emailed to wac500@htomail.co.uk, before tomorrow (Saturday).
The envelopes will be opened in the Dolphin Hotel at 7.30pm tomorrow night.
